Abstract
The utility model relates to an all -hydraulic formula both arms electro -hydraulic hammer that puts to one side, including host computer both arms and surface railway, surface railway is arranged to one side in to the host computer both arms, and vertical centring cross -section on the host computer both arms and surface railway put angle setting to one side between 30~60. The utility model discloses can realize following beneficial effect: 1, through putting the host computer both arms to one side on not changing the basis of former both arms electro -hydraulic hammer first wife facility, vacate the both sides space of host computer both arms, 2, can add the auxiliary machinery hand in the space of vacateing to form the integration intelligent automation mechanized operation, for improving work efficiency, reduction recruitment cost, energy saving consumption, promoting and make the quality, create prerequisite.
Description
Technical field
This utility model relates to a kind of all-hydraulic both arms Single arm, particularly relate to a kind of both arms column and be inclined in main frame, make main frame can set up subsidiary engine on the basis of existing auxiliary facility, thus realize the all-hydraulic both arms Single arm structure of Based Intelligent Control, belong to metal forming machinery design and manufacturing technology field.
Background technology
All-hydraulic both arms Single arm is that hydraulic power is directly acted on tup moving component by one, so that tup has the forging equipment of striking capabilities, because it has the advantage such as energy-saving and environmental protection, easy to operate, laborsaving, flexible movements reliable, system working stability, safety rational in infrastructure, and it is known as state-of-the-art technology both at home and abroad.But, in all multi-form both arms Single arm, have intelligent automation control comprehensively operation function but for blank.Thus when forging large forgings, often both arms Single arm needs staff the most up to 12 people being equipped with, more than its operator's quantity, labor intensity is big, work efficiency is low, is also apparent from.Trace it to its cause, it is seen that the work space around both arms Single arm is fairly limited, when the longitudinal direction before and after main frame configures track, run after clamping the mechanical hand of workpiece on track, remaining space the most directly can be confined to the range of activity of operator, as the subsidiary engine of configuration required for the subsidiary engine of configuration required for the mechanical hand passed to by workpiece from heating furnace on track and clamping mould with to be necessarily placed at the other die storehouse of subsidiary engine etc. then basic without space configuration.Therefore, the narrow space that both arms Single arm column is other is to restrict the very crux that its intelligent automation controls.In other words, it is intended to intelligent automation advanced technology is referred to both arms Single arm, is necessary for solving the space problem that both arms Single arm column is other.Otherwise, intelligent automation controls technology on all-hydraulic both arms Single arm equipment just without the soil of existence.
Summary of the invention
The purpose of this utility model seeks to provide a kind of all-hydraulic inclined type both arms Single arm, run the relative position of track with mechanical hand by scientific and reasonable layout Single arm both arms, make intelligentized subsidiary engine obtain reasonable disposition, thus realize the intellectuality of both arms Single arm, automatization comprehensively.
To achieve these goals, this utility model takes techniques below scheme to be implemented: a kind of all-hydraulic inclined type both arms Single arm, including main frame both arms, anvil block, ground rail and the mechanical hand of two clamping workpiece, described anvil block is fixed in the ground base between main frame both arms;Described ground rail is two-section, and wherein one section is placed in anvil block side, and another section is placed in the opposite side of anvil block, and two-section track is put mutually on the extended line of the other side;The mechanical hand of described two clamping forge pieces is placed on two-section ground rail, and can seesaw towards anvil block in orbit, it is characterised in that:
Vertical centre cross section and the included angle of ground rail that described main frame both arms are inclined on ground rail, and main frame both arms are arranged between 30 °~60 °.
Compared with existing all-hydraulic both arms Single arm, this utility model can realize following beneficial effect:
1, by tilting main frame both arms, one mechanical hand of main frame OPS Yu clamping forge piece can be arranged on one side of main frame both arms, another mechanical hand of clamping forge piece is arranged on the another side of main frame both arms, thus on the basis of not changing both arms Single arm first wife's facility, vacates the space, both sides of main frame both arms;
2, in main frame both arms arrange main frame OPS and clamping forge piece one mechanical hand space on one side, the auxiliary manipulator of transmission blank can be set up, in main frame both arms arrange another mechanical hand of clamping forge piece space on one side, not only can set up another auxiliary manipulator of transmission blank, also can set up and grip the auxiliary manipulator of forging die and the die storehouse supporting with it;
3, because a series of auxiliary manipulator can be set up around main frame both arms, therefore integrated intelligent automation mechanized operation can be formed, manufacture quality, creation prerequisite for raising work efficiency, reduction recruitment cost, saving energy resource consumption, lifting.
Accompanying drawing explanation
Accompanying drawing 1 arranges structural representation for of the present utility model.
In fig. 1: 1 main frame both arms, 2 main frame OPSs, 3 anvil blocks, 4 and 4 ' transmission the auxiliary manipulator of blank, 5 ground rails, 6 and 6 ' clamping forge piece mechanical hand, 7 grip the auxiliary manipulator of forging die, 8 die storehouses.
Detailed description of the invention
Below in conjunction with accompanying drawing this utility model is further explained explanation:
As shown in Figure 1, anvil block 3 is fixed in the ground base between main frame both arms 1;Ground rail 5 is two-section, and wherein one section is placed in anvil block 3 side, and another section is placed in the opposite side of anvil block 3, and two-section track is placed in the extended line of the other side mutually;The mechanical hand 6 and 6 ' of two clamping forge pieces is placed on two-section ground rail 5, and can seesaw towards anvil block 3 in orbit;The vertical centre cross section that main frame both arms 1 are inclined on ground rail 5, and main frame both arms 1 is set to 35 with the included angle of ground rail 5.
Owing to the main frame both arms 1 in this utility model are inclined in ground rail 5, therefore the mechanical hand 6 of the main frame OPS 2 on former both arms Single arm with clamping forge piece can be arranged on one side of main frame both arms 1, mechanical hand 6 ' by another clamping forge piece is arranged on the another side of main frame both arms 1, thus on the basis of not changing former both arms Single arm first wife's facility, vacate the space, both sides of main frame both arms 1;Owing to having vacateed above-mentioned space, therefore can be in main frame both arms 1 arrange the space on mechanical hand 6 one side of main frame OPS 2 and clamping workpiece, set up the auxiliary manipulator 4 of transmission blank, in main frame both arms 1 arrange the space on mechanical hand 6 ' one side of clamping forge piece, not only set up the auxiliary manipulator 4 ' of transmission blank, also can set up and grip the auxiliary manipulator 7 of forging die and the die storehouse 8 supporting with it, thus form integrated intelligent Automated condtrol for all-hydraulic both arms Single arm and create essential condition.
